<p class="MsoNormal"><span lang="EN-GB">The easiest option is to verify against a small subset of the DNL Since the full DNL isn't checked, no claims will be presented after the mandatory 90 days for names that were available during that period.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al">Claims would only be presented on names that come off the reserved list and are also on the DNL list.<o:p></o:p></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al">The &quot;claims check&quot; would be against a sub-list of the DNL list, instead of checking the entire list.<o:p></o:p></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al">This works for reserved names and for NXD names when they become available.<o:p></o:p></p>

<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D">That&#8217;s exactly the way we will implement this. However, as we noticed recently, the TMCH *rejects* LORDN-entries for Claims once a registry
 moves beyond the &#8220;official&#8221; Claims Phase (as indicated on the ICANN startup schedule page). The TMCH responsds with an 4606 error (&#8220;TLD not in Sunrise or Claims&#8221;).<o:p></o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D"><o:p>&nbsp;</o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D">That means that after the &#8220;official&#8221; 90-day Claims phase has ended for a TLD, the registry operator actually *can&#8217;t* use the standard LORDN
 reporting process to submit domain names that required claims. Since i&#8217;m not aware of any other mechanism to report such Claims cases to the Clearinghouse, it seems to me that ICANN has created a requirement that doesn&#8217;t seem to be implemented right now.<o:p></o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D"><o:p>&nbsp;</o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D">So, without &nbsp;either: a) the TMCH accepting LORDN files *beyond* the standard claims phase (preferred, since it doesn&#8217;t require *any* change
 on the registry/registrar side!) or b) ICANN/TMCH proposing a different solution for reporting of Claims associated with such &#8220;Late Claims&#8221; cases, i don&#8217;t see how a registry could currently fulfil that requirement.<o:p></o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D"><o:p>&nbsp;</o:p></span></i></b></p>
<p class="MsoNormal"><b><i><span lang="EN-GB" style="font-size:11.0pt;font-family:&quot;Calibri&quot;,&quot;sans-serif&quot;;color:#1F497D">We&#8217;ll continue to send the respective reporting LORDN files, even though the TMCH does reject them. At least we tried. However, i&#8217;m definitely
